哟是英特尔® Edison 模块?

英特尔® Edison
模块 是一模一样栽 SD
卡大小的小型计算芯片,专为构建物联网 (IoT) 和可穿戴计算产品而设计。
Edison 模块内含一个快的双核处理单元、集成 Wi-Fi*、蓝牙*
低能耗、存储和内存、以及用于和用户系统进行交互的普遍输入/输出 (I/O)
选件。 Edison
模块占用空间稍加、功耗低,是用强大处理动力但无能为力连接电源的类之出色之选。

Edison 模块可坐至装备或者开发板中,以博得连接和电源。
为协用户迅速使该模块,英特尔® 提供了面向 Arduino* 的英特尔® Edison
套件 和 英特尔®
Edison Breakout
开发板套件*,可助您加速构建原型。
对于生安排,您还可以创建于定义开发板。

借助于面向 Arduino* 的英特尔® Edison 套件,您可以在周边运用的 Arduino
软件开发环境面临以开源硬件快速、轻松地构建原型。 该套件允许你扩展 Edison
模块以连续现有的 Arduino UNO R3 Shield,从而扩大功能。 英特尔® Edison
Breakout 开发板套件最主要提供了电源及 USB 连接选件;例如,您得拿 Edison
开发板连接到笔记本电脑的 USB 端口并飞速启动。

花特尔® Edison 模块概览

希冀 1 显示了 Edison 模块的组织图。

qg111钱柜娱乐官网 1
图 1. 英特尔® Edison 模块的结构图

 

[材料来源: http://download.intel.com/support/edison/sb/edisonmodule_hg_331189004.pdf]

拖欠模块包括同样发时钟频率为 500 MHz 的英特尔® 凌动™ 处理器以及 4GB 托管闪存。
默认情况下,Yocto Linux* 操作系统安装在闪存被。

对 Wi-Fi 和蓝牙低会淘连接,该模块包含一个 Broadcom BCM43340
网卡,支持标准的双频带 2.4 GHz 和 5 GHz IEEE 802.11 a/b/g/n 标准、以及
Wi-Fi 保护性接入 (WPA) 和
WPA2(个人),因此可提供有力的加密和身份验证功能。
该连选项支持以标准方式重新自在地用 Edison 模块嵌入式设备连到现有的
Wi-Fi 基础设备。 蓝牙低会淘支持 Edison
设备连接其他蓝牙低会消耗设备,例如智能手机,以便智能手机可用作连接互联网的网关。
物联网产品的连年选项是计划性物联网产品如何连接至互联网世界经常的一个重要设想因素。
Edison
模块支持有限种植使最广的连续选项,可助用户会轻轻松松地推出实际产品。
Edison 模块通过 Hirose 70 针 DF40 系列连接器与用户系统相互,其中 40
针专用于通用 I/O (GPIO)。

Edison
模块提供了一致法只是依靠要破例的意义,包括小外形、高速对查处处理器、低功耗用例、标准连接选项和广阔的
I/O 支持等。 这些特征能够支持构建创时互联解决方案的各种用例。

花儿特尔® Edison 模块编程

否 Edison 模块编程时,可应用 C、C++、Python* 或 JavaScript*
(Node.js*) 编程语言。 在 Edison
开发板或设施上出及调节设备代码时, 而是根据编程环境下载并开发环境
(IDE)。
例如,您可以下载适用于 JavaScript 的英特尔® XDK、适用于 C/C++的英特尔®
System Studio IoT Edition、适用于 Java 的英特尔® System Studio IoT
Edition、或支持吗 Edison 开发板和 Arduino 编程的 Arduino IDE。 IDE
的选在项目及其设备要求,以及您用来跟设备交互的编程语言。

英特尔提供 Libmraa* 库,以支持和 Edison
设备(或外受支持之装备)上之传感器和致动器进行互。 Libmraa
在支撑之硬件顶部提供一个抽象层,以便你为规范方法读取传感器以及致动器的数,并创造适用于支持平台的便携式代码。
如欲查阅不同制造商生产的适用于 Edison 设备的传感器以及刹车,请浏览
GitHub* 的发出因此软件包跟模块 (UPM) 传感器/制动器资源库
(https://github.com/intel-iot-devkit/upm))。
UPM 是一个含各种传感器的高级资源库,为使 Libmraa
库与传感器相并提供了业内模式。
借助大使用的编程语言选择和含有各种传感器项目之社区,您可再次采用现有的编程知识来开发互联产品,并以
Libmraa 库与面向 I/O 功能的 GPIO 针轻松进行互动。

以 Edison 设备连至道平台

冲物联网解决方案,您得将 Edison
设备连至道平台,以便对传感器数据进行更计算和高级分析。 Edison
设备能够为连续到领先云平台供无缝支持,例如 Microsoft
Azure*、 IBM
Watson*
物联网平台、或 Amazon Web
Services* (AWS*)等。

这些云平台通常提供用 C++、Python 或 JavaScript 的软件开发套件 (SDK)
或设施 SDK,能够又轻松地接连 Edison 设备(或擅自相关设施)。
典型的付出流程是预先念博设备的传感器数据,然后经过叫支持的协商,例如 SDK
库的信息队列遥测传输 (MQTT) 或高档消息队列协议
(AMQP),将传感器数据传至道平台。 请点击以下链接,了解怎么以 Edison
设备连至道平台的详情:

  • 使用 IBM Watson* 物联网平台及英特尔®
    物联网设备与网关
  • 使用 Microsoft Azure*物联网套件和英特尔®
    物联网设备及网关
  • 使用 Amazon Web Services* (AWS)
    物联网和英特尔®物联网设备和网关

假如一旦高效在手构建物联网应用,您还得打包括 Edison
开发板且预安装云平台连接选项的入门套件。 如欲了解详情,请点击以下链接:

  • 由 AWS* 驱动之英特尔® Edison 开发板和 Grove*
    室内环境套件
  • IBM*
    云可简化物联网开发
  • 花儿特尔以及 Microsoft
    携手提供更佳体验

您将付出哪些创意产品?

Edison 模块将为您构建面向消费者及工业用例的通力产品提供极致机遇:

  • 买主用例。 用例包括将 Edison
    模块嵌入至手表或正常设备相当可过戴设备中,以钉各种正规与生方式参数,或放到下用自动化设备受到以控制打设备或者智能地以能源。
  • 顶分析。 借助高速的对仗审核处理器以及低功耗,Edison
    模块可坐到工业装备遭遇,以提供当地分析以及计算支持。
    用例包括于装置上本土运行分析或算法,以根据实际条件保障机械设备,以及由此图片分析和对象识别发送告警,以监视并保证智能建筑的安。

至于创客还会使这个微型的更新模块构建的另外项目之音讯,请参考:

  • 物联网产品实现之同:
    如何构建智能家庭原型
  • 英特尔® 物联网技术代码样本入门: 使用 C++
    编写供水系统 
  • 海量qg111钱柜娱乐官网传感器数据的分析
  • 使用 Cylon.js* 和英特尔® Edison
    开发板控制机器人
  • 由此当英特尔 Edison
    上实施支持于量机开发手语识别
  • Reach: 基于英特尔® Edison 的配备助力为具人数构建经济适用的强精度
    GPS
  • Hackster.io,Edison 开发板项目以及新意社区
    (https://www.hackster.io/intel/products/intel-edison)

总结

本文重点介绍了英特尔® Edison
模块会同硬件标准和中心特性集,这些特征可为创客构建互联产品提供前所未有的机。
此外,本文还介绍了 Edison 模块支持的编程语言、可用之 IDE
以及可帮快速支付与布置 Edison 设备的 Libmraa 库。
最后,本文还介绍了怎么以 Edison 设备连接到道平台跟发现的 Edison
技术从而例。 Edison 模块具备多功力,可助您充分发挥想象力,打造最可能。

相关文章